| joe411:
http://AdNauseam.io AdNauseam is essentially uBlock origin, but it also silently clicks each ad that's blocked, essentially tricking the advertiser. Because of this, many advirtisers are asking for refunds due to fake ad clicks. https://www.wsj.com/articles/google-issuing-refunds-to-advertisers-over-fake-traffic-plans-new-safeguard-1503675395 If you're pissed at Google for the whole adpocalypse thing, this is probably the best way to protest it.
